    Default Die Reichswehr Im Bild: Infantry Regiment 14

    Hi

    Selection of pictures from an album of a former member of IR 14, part of the 5th Division. Sadly the album had been broken up so analysing it has proved difficult. The owners battalion and company remains a mystery but the pictures cover the era 1928 - 1933.

    They show a broad range of subjects: formal portraits, pictures with friends, boxing and gymnastics; Xmas; day trips out.....
